Marlène Chiarello is a scholar working on Ecology, Molecular Biology and Microbi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Marlène Chiarello has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 434 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Ecology, 2 papers in Molecular Biology and 2 papers in Microbiology. Recurrent topics in Marlène Chiarello's work include Microbial Community Ecology and Physiology (3 papers),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(3 papers) and Aquatic Invertebrate Ecology and Behavior (3 papers). Marlène Chiarello is often cited by papers focused on Microbial Community Ecology and Physiology (3 papers),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(3 papers) and Aquatic Invertebrate Ecology and Behavior (3 papers). Marlène Chiarello coll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and United Kingdom. Marlène Chiarello's co-authors include Sébastien Villéger, Thierry Bouvier, Colin R. Jackson, Corinne Bouvier, Mark McCauley, Yvan Bettarel, Jean‐Christophe Auguet, Nicholas A. J. Graham, Thomas Claverie and Carla L. Atkinson and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Scientific Reports and Proceedings of the Royal Society B Biological Sciences.
